Demographics details for Oak grove, KY vs Lakewood, CO
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Oak grove, KY vs Lakewood, CO.
Data | Oak grove | Lakewood |
---|---|---|
Population | 7,997 | 156,120 |
Median Age | 24.6 years | 38.1 years |
Median Income | $40,740 | $82,786 |
Married Families | 24.0% | 38.0% |
Poverty Level | Data is updating | 9% |
Unemployment Rate | 3.5 | 4.1 |

Health Statistics
The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.
Health Metric | Oak grove | Lakewood |
---|---|---|
Mental Health Not Good | 19.6% | 14.4% |
Physical Health Not Good | 15.0% | 9.7% |
Depression | 27.8% | 20.5% |
Smoking | 23.0% | 14.1% |
Binge Drinking | 14.1% | 21.3% |
Obesity | 39.9% | 25.3% |
Disability Percentage | 15.0% | 12.0% |
